Commit Graph

1198 Commits

Author SHA1 Message Date
milek
075d88e8d7 fix stdafx cotire 2019-03-25 20:56:22 +00:00
milek
810ea151e2 fix compiling on MacOS 2019-03-25 20:23:32 +00:00
milek7
1fba251baf change __linux__ to __unix__ 2019-03-25 20:20:22 +00:00
milek
c09160d8f5 uart now optional, macos openal fix 2019-03-25 20:20:10 +00:00
milek7
aaf67caae2 Merge branch 'master' of https://github.com/Xoov/maszyna into milek-dev 2019-03-23 12:41:34 +01:00
milek7
f117801edc Merge branch 'tmj-dev' into milek-dev 2019-03-23 12:36:56 +01:00
Królik Uszasty
511d1c57d9 Added SpeedCtrl for TRAXX 2019-03-23 11:51:24 +01:00
Królik Uszasty
8fddbadbaf Fix for AI decoupling old Knorr/West locomotives 2019-03-23 08:52:47 +01:00
Królik Uszasty
e4dca57de4 Merge remote-tracking branch 'refs/remotes/TMJ/master' 2019-03-23 08:01:13 +01:00
tmj-fstate
ae5daac939 minor bug fixes 2019-03-23 01:54:26 +01:00
Królik Uszasty
a767e36be8 AI does not fear SlippingWheels when driving ElectricInductionMotor vehicle + fix for adhesion calculation when slipping 2019-03-22 21:44:04 +01:00
tmj-fstate
73af767312 audio transcript sound volume based filtering, minor ai logic fixes 2019-03-22 21:43:36 +01:00
Królik Uszasty
14e3a27026 AI does not fear SlippingWheels when driving ElectricInductionMotor vehicle + fix for adhesion calculation when slipping 2019-03-22 20:26:59 +01:00
tmj-fstate
faaabf116b build 190322. support for vehicle load visualization model override, skydome brightness tweaks 2019-03-22 15:45:20 +01:00
Królik Uszasty
df068534d4 Fix for Handle=H14K1 with BrakeValve=K 2019-03-22 00:13:45 +01:00
Królik Uszasty
75cc0b2a24 Fix for autoreturning controller 2019-03-22 00:13:41 +01:00
Królik Uszasty
ea8b38489a AI does not fear accelerating a bit too fast 2019-03-22 00:13:38 +01:00
Królik Uszasty
a3af2453a0 Reworked main brake handle usage by AI - it can use time-dependent handles now. 2019-03-22 00:13:33 +01:00
Królik Uszasty
019a0c2cf6 Preparation for rework of main brake handle usage by AI 2019-03-22 00:13:29 +01:00
Królik Uszasty
3f12f9231f Vehicles with EIMCtrlType>0 use integrated controller instead of localbrake handle 2019-03-22 00:13:23 +01:00
Królik Uszasty
be63aa7452 Fix for Handle=H14K1 with BrakeValve=K 2019-03-21 23:17:41 +01:00
Królik Uszasty
91a7a94682 Fix for autoreturning controller 2019-03-21 21:47:35 +01:00
Królik Uszasty
403c29746d AI does not fear accelerating a bit too fast 2019-03-21 17:47:16 +01:00
Królik Uszasty
3fd408bd46 Reworked main brake handle usage by AI - it can use time-dependent handles now. 2019-03-21 17:25:05 +01:00
Królik Uszasty
ef1ccb448a Preparation for rework of main brake handle usage by AI 2019-03-21 15:27:10 +01:00
Królik Uszasty
72fa1c22a2 Vehicles with EIMCtrlType>0 use integrated controller instead of localbrake handle 2019-03-21 09:50:40 +01:00
Królik Uszasty
b600d0fb85 Merge with TMJ 2019-03-21 08:03:36 +01:00
tmj-fstate
ab16fc17d9 vehicle controllers ai logic fixes 2019-03-21 01:36:29 +01:00
tmj-fstate
fe6789778f vehicle controllers ai logic fixes, minor refactoring 2019-03-19 22:38:46 +01:00
tmj-fstate
3edd22e9fa diesel engine startup check fix 2019-03-17 19:45:45 +01:00
Królik Uszasty
4855b3a5a5 New Handle type MHZ_6P for Traxx 2019-03-17 19:09:29 +01:00
Królik Uszasty
fb36c1348b Fix for MHZ_K5P - no sudden overload in middle posistion 2019-03-17 19:09:16 +01:00
Królik Uszasty
ea5f3ae27a Fixed SpeedControl for EN57-like EMUs 2019-03-17 19:09:09 +01:00
tmj-fstate
04db86baa6 cooling fans state indicator, minor diesel engine logic tweaks 2019-03-17 19:08:53 +01:00
milek7
7daf38b169 Merge commit '6b56fbddbeb231f28fd11c08c88dd4ef95db8f93' into milek-dev 2019-03-16 21:08:25 +01:00
Królik Uszasty
6b56fbddbe New Handle type MHZ_6P for Traxx 2019-03-16 20:43:12 +01:00
milek7
4bc90cdd19 Merge branch 'tmj-dev' into milek-dev 2019-03-16 01:37:38 +01:00
Królik Uszasty
ca0c904d6a Fix for MHZ_K5P - no sudden overload in middle posistion 2019-03-15 20:41:11 +01:00
Królik Uszasty
1151925e1b Fixed SpeedControl for EN57-like EMUs 2019-03-15 12:31:34 +01:00
Królik Uszasty
8d67338950 Small fix to eimic and speedcontrol interaction 2019-03-14 20:11:04 +01:00
Królik Uszasty
3de04fdb67 SpeedCntrl affects also first vehicle now 2019-03-14 20:10:52 +01:00
tmj-fstate
cf91f7e031 cooling fan cab control, dedicated tempomat cab control, minor vehicle preparation ai logic tweaks, minor timetable ui panel tweaks 2019-03-14 20:09:30 +01:00
Królik Uszasty
7249ffd068 Small fix to eimic and speedcontrol interaction 2019-03-14 18:58:31 +01:00
Królik Uszasty
f02d30fd9a SpeedCntrl affects also first vehicle now 2019-03-14 14:44:19 +01:00
Królik Uszasty
b8ff8703c5 AI now uses EIMCtrlType no 1 and 2 correctly 2019-03-12 19:02:04 +01:00
Królik Uszasty
05f0fbb7dd Added instant 0 for EIMCtrlType == 1 (Traxx) 2019-03-12 19:01:48 +01:00
Królik Uszasty
18e46aa063 Corrected shifting speed for EIMCtrlType == 2 2019-03-12 19:01:30 +01:00
Królik Uszasty
868c86c6e2 Corrected "desired percent" for Python screens 2019-03-12 19:00:32 +01:00
Królik Uszasty
69ad8943ae New MainCtrlTypes for EIM Integrated Control dedicated to Traxx and Elf 2019-03-12 18:59:17 +01:00
Królik Uszasty
90df9b9b12 Unified multiplier for "brakes" gauge with other pneumatic gauges 2019-03-12 18:56:31 +01:00